Os materiais didáticos aqui disponibilizados estão licenciados através de Creative Commons Atribuição-SemDerivações-SemDerivados CC BY-NC-ND. Você possui a permissão para visualizar e compartilhar, desde que atribua os créditos do autor. Não poderá alterá-los e nem utilizá-los para fins comerciais.
Atribuição-SemDerivações-SemDerivados
CC BY-NC-ND
Cursos / Jogos Digitais / Lógica de Programação / Aula
Construa um programa com 2 vetores, cada um de 10 posições. O seu algoritmo receberá 15 números inteiros. Os números ímpares deverão ser armazenados no primeiro vetor. Já os pares serão armazenados no segundo vetor. Se um vetor ficar cheio (completar as 10 posições) durante a leitura dos valores, você deverá "descartar" o valor mais antigo (a primeira posição do vetor) e mover as posições subsequentes em "uma casa para esquerda" para que seja possível armazenar o 10º valor. Repita essa operação quantas vezes for necessário, até que todos os 15 valores sejam lidos pelo seu programa.
Ao final, o algoritmo deverá imprimir os números armazenados no primeiro vetor em uma linha, e os armazenados no segundo vetor na linha imediatamente abaixo. Os números devem estar separados por um espaço em branco simples.
feedbackVocê ainda não realizou tentativas nesse exercício.
thumb_upTudo OK!! Pode comemorar! \o/
thumbs_up_downMais ou menos OK, por que não tentar melhorar o resultado?
thumb_downO resultado não foi como gostaríamos, que tal verificar seu algoritmo e tentar novamente?
Processando o seu código, por favor aguarde...
feedbackVocê ainda não realizou tentativas nesse exercício.
Processando o seu código, por favor aguarde...
Versão 5.3 - Todos os Direitos reservados